Normal curvatures and Euler classes for polyhedral surfaces in $4$-space
HTML articles powered by AMS MathViewer

by Thomas F. Banchoff PDF
Proc. Amer. Math. Soc. 92 (1984), 593-596 Request permission

Abstract:

Using the approach of singularities of projections into lower dimensional spaces it is possible to define nonintrinsic local curvature quantities at each vertex of a polyhedral surface immersed in $4$-space which add up to the normal Euler number of the immersion. Related uniqueness results for lattice polyhedra have been established by B. Yusin.
